]> git.donarmstrong.com Git - lilypond.git/blobdiff - lily/key-performer.cc
* Documentation/user/lilypond.tely: Add dir entries for
[lilypond.git] / lily / key-performer.cc
index a14edf077bfa730ba0cf3c30c83c2ed552bee71f..7401a637de01672927c1ce887d804afc064152bd 100644 (file)
@@ -10,6 +10,7 @@
 #include "command-request.hh"
 #include "audio-item.hh"
 #include "performer.hh"
+#include "warn.hh"
 
 
 class Key_performer : public Performer
@@ -19,19 +20,19 @@ public:
   ~Key_performer ();
 
 protected:
-  virtual bool try_music (Music* req_l);
+  virtual bool try_music (Music* req);
   virtual void create_audio_elements ();
   virtual void stop_translation_timestep ();
 
 private:
-  Key_change_req* key_req_l_;
-  Audio_key* audio_p_;
+  Key_change_req* key_req_;
+  Audio_key* audio_;
 };
 
 Key_performer::Key_performer ()
 {
-  key_req_l_ = 0;
-  audio_p_ = 0;
+  key_req_ = 0;
+  audio_ = 0;
 }
 
 Key_performer::~Key_performer ()
@@ -41,9 +42,9 @@ Key_performer::~Key_performer ()
 void
 Key_performer::create_audio_elements ()
 {
-  if (key_req_l_
+  if (key_req_) 
     {
-      SCM pitchlist = key_req_l_->get_mus_property ("pitch-alist");
+      SCM pitchlist = key_req_->get_mus_property ("pitch-alist");
       SCM proc = scm_primitive_eval (ly_symbol2scm ("accidentals-in-key")); 
       SCM acc = gh_call1 (proc, pitchlist);
       proc = scm_primitive_eval (ly_symbol2scm ("major-key"));
@@ -57,7 +58,7 @@ Key_performer::create_audio_elements ()
                   -gh_scm2int (ly_cdar (pitchlist)));
 
       my_do.transpose (to_c);
-      to_c.alteration_i_ -= my_do.alteration_i_;
+      to_c.alteration_ -= my_do.alteration_;
 
       Key_change_req *key = new Key_change_req;
       key->set_mus_property ("pitch-alist", scm_list_copy (pitchlist));
@@ -65,32 +66,32 @@ Key_performer::create_audio_elements ()
       SCM c_pitchlist = key->get_mus_property ("pitch-alist");
       SCM major = gh_call1 (proc, c_pitchlist);
 
-      audio_p_ = new Audio_key (gh_scm2int (acc), major == SCM_BOOL_T); 
-      Audio_element_info info (audio_p_, key_req_l_);
+      audio_ = new Audio_key (gh_scm2int (acc), major == SCM_BOOL_T); 
+      Audio_element_info info (audio_, key_req_);
       announce_element (info);
-      key_req_l_ = 0;
+      key_req_ = 0;
     }
 }
 
 void
 Key_performer::stop_translation_timestep ()
 {
-  if (audio_p_)
+  if (audio_)
     {
-      play_element (audio_p_);
-      audio_p_ = 0;
+      play_element (audio_);
+      audio_ = 0;
     }
 }
 
 bool
-Key_performer::try_music (Music* req_l)
+Key_performer::try_music (Music* req)
 {
-  if (Key_change_req *kc = dynamic_cast <Key_change_req *> (req_l))
+  if (Key_change_req *kc = dynamic_cast <Key_change_req *> (req))
     {
-      if (key_req_l_)
+      if (key_req_)
        warning (_ ("FIXME: key change merge"));
 
-      key_req_l_ = kc;
+      key_req_ = kc;
       return true;
     }